A huge milestone for the international committee of the Red Cross. The organization is preparing to mark its 150th anniversary. The committee met for the first time on February 17th, 1863. The organization provided video of its efforts, over the years to assist millions of people around the world.
From trench warfare, during the First World War to present day conflicts, the Red Cross has helped victims of armed conflict for the past 150 years. Its president says the 150th anniversary offers an opportunity to look toward the future and focus on new challenges to humanitarian action.
